EDAC: Introduce an mci_for_each_dimm() iterator
Introduce an mci_for_each_dimm() iterator. It returns a pointer to a struct dimm_info. This makes the declaration and use of an index obsolete and avoids access to internal data of struct mci (direct array access etc).
